Home Remedies to Cure a Hangover

A throbbing headache, a dry mouth, bloodshot eyes, nausea and general dizziness…even this vivid description of a hangover is better than the actual effects! Most of us pop painkillers to alleviate the discomfort and pain associated with a hangover, but we all know that pain relieving pills come packed with awful side effects; natural remedies are therefore a better option any day. There are two kinds of natural remedies, the preventive ones, which can help you avoid a hangover and the second type can help in curing a hangover. The following is a list of both-


Preventive home remedies-


  • Drink a glass of water after every drink; this will save you from the dehydrating effects of alcohol.
  • Have at least 2-3 glasses of water before going to bed, you’ll probably have to get up in the middle of the night to pee, but it will at least save you from the awful morning hangover.
  • Make sure you don’t go to bed without eating, you may feel like hitting the bed after a hard night of partying, but a light meal in all probability will save you from a hangover in the morning.



Hangover cures-


Lots of water- Your dehydrated body needs water to feel better. Water can also induce vomiting and throwing up will help in alleviating your headache and general discomfort. Of course you’ll need to drink more water after throwing up, to prevent further dehydration.
Banana shake with honey- Add a teaspoon of honey to glass of banana shake and drink it up. While the banana will help in restoring the level of potassium in your body (excess alcohol lowers potassium levels), honey will help in digesting the alcohol still present in your body.


Ginger and orange drink- Add 5-6 slices of ginger to two cups of boiling water, now add half a cup of orange juice, 1 teaspoon of lemon juice and half a cup of honey to this concoction. Let it cool and then drink it up. This drink will help restore the sugar levels in your body.


Finally, a greasy breakfast is also said to cure the side effects of a hangover. However, you must remember that being patient is essential as none of these cures can produce instant results.
